CNA

chapter 22 vocabulary

TermDefinition
anesthesia the use of medication to block pain during surgery and other medical procedures
preoperative before surgery
postoperative after surgery
pulse oxmeter a noninvasive device that uses light to determine the amount of oxygen in the blood
telemetry a cardiac monitoring device that sends information about the heart's rhythm and rate to a monitoring station
artificial airway any tube inserted into the respiratory tract to maintain or promote breathing
intubation the passage of a plastic tube through the mouth, nose or opening in the neck and into the trachea
tracheostomy a surgically created opening through the neck into the trachea
mechanical ventilation the use of a machine to inflate and deflate the lungs when a person is unable to breathe on his own
sedative an agent or drug that helps calm and soothe a person and may cause sleep
chest tubes hollow drainage tubes that are inserted into the chest to drain air, blood, or other fluids or pus that has collected inside the pleural cavity or space
